您现在的位置是:首页 >科技 > 2025-03-09 10:39:55 来源:

利用C语言实现数组的排序(冒泡排序法)🎨

导读 在这个数字化时代,编程成为了不可或缺的一部分。今天,让我们一起探索如何使用C语言中的冒泡排序法来对数组进行排序吧!✨冒泡排序是一种

在这个数字化时代,编程成为了不可或缺的一部分。今天,让我们一起探索如何使用C语言中的冒泡排序法来对数组进行排序吧!✨

冒泡排序是一种简单的排序算法,它重复地走访过要排序的数列,一次比较两个元素,如果他们的顺序错误就把他们交换过来。走访数列的工作是重复地进行直到没有再需要交换,也就是说该数列已经排序完成。🎈

首先,我们需要定义一个数组,例如 `int arr[] = {64, 34, 25, 12, 22, 11, 90};` 这是一个未排序的整型数组。🚀

接下来,我们需要创建一个函数来实现冒泡排序。这个函数将接受数组和数组的大小作为参数,并通过循环不断地比较相邻的元素,如果前一个元素大于后一个元素,则交换它们的位置。这样一来,每次循环都能把当前最大的元素“冒泡”到数组的末尾。🌊

最后,我们可以在主函数中调用这个冒泡排序函数,并打印排序后的数组以验证结果。这样,我们就成功地使用C语言实现了冒泡排序算法。🎉

通过以上步骤,我们可以轻松地对数组进行排序,为后续的数据处理提供了极大的便利。希望这篇文章能帮助你更好地理解并掌握冒泡排序法!📚

C语言 冒泡排序 编程基础